Python可变参数会自动填充前面的默认同名参数实例


Posted in Python onNovember 18, 2019

最近在学习Python的时候遇到一个知识点,在此记录下来

可变参数会自动填充前面的同名默认参数

比如下面这个函数

def add_student(name="Bob", **info_dict):
  print(name)

如果info_dict里面也有name,当我们这样调用时

info_dict = {
  "name" : "Tom",
  "age" : 20
}


add_student(**info_dict)# Tom

那么name虽然设置了默认值,仍然会被填充为info_dict中的name值

以上这篇Python可变参数会自动填充前面的默认同名参数实例就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持三水点靠木。

Python 相关文章推荐
Python 使用SMTP发送邮件的代码小结
Sep 21 Python
对python中return和print的一些理解
Aug 18 Python
Python实现简易版的Web服务器(推荐)
Jan 29 Python
用Django实现一个可运行的区块链应用
Mar 08 Python
Python中str.join()简单用法示例
Mar 20 Python
解决pycharm界面不能显示中文的问题
May 23 Python
python开启摄像头以及深度学习实现目标检测方法
Aug 03 Python
对python 生成拼接xml报文的示例详解
Dec 28 Python
jupyter notebook 中输出pyecharts图实例
Apr 23 Python
在pycharm中为项目导入anacodna环境的操作方法
Feb 12 Python
python中np是做什么的
Jul 21 Python
python实现人性化显示金额数字实例详解
Sep 25 Python
python tornado修改log输出方式
Nov 18 #Python
Python3常用内置方法代码实例
Nov 18 #Python
python tornado使用流生成图片的例子
Nov 18 #Python
解决pandas展示数据输出时列名不能对齐的问题
Nov 18 #Python
python 实现绘制整齐的表格
Nov 18 #Python
wxPython色环电阻计算器
Nov 18 #Python
Python模拟登录之滑块验证码的破解(实例代码)
Nov 18 #Python
You might like
Memcache 在PHP中的使用技巧
2010/02/08 PHP
提高define性能的php扩展hidef的安装和使用
2011/06/14 PHP
php中file_get_contents与curl性能比较分析
2014/11/08 PHP
Laravel 5.1 on SAE环境开发教程【附项目demo源码】
2016/10/09 PHP
Zend Framework框架实现类似Google搜索分页效果
2016/11/25 PHP
PHP htmlspecialchars() 函数实例代码及用法大全
2018/09/18 PHP
laravel-admin 实现在指定的相册下添加照片
2019/10/21 PHP
js 判断文件类型并控制表单提交示例代码
2013/11/14 Javascript
javascript如何实现暂停功能
2015/11/06 Javascript
关于Stream和Buffer的相互转换详解
2017/07/26 Javascript
react实现菜单权限控制的方法
2017/12/11 Javascript
vuex的简单使用教程
2018/02/02 Javascript
babel之配置文件.babelrc入门详解
2018/02/22 Javascript
使用jquery DataTable和ajax向页面显示数据列表的方法
2018/08/09 jQuery
在element-ui的el-tree组件中用render函数生成el-button的实例代码
2018/11/05 Javascript
使用Vue实现移动端左滑删除效果附源码
2019/05/16 Javascript
node.JS二进制操作模块buffer对象使用方法详解
2020/02/06 Javascript
vue-cli+webpack项目打包到服务器后,ttf字体找不到的解决操作
2020/08/28 Javascript
[01:13:59]LGD vs Mineski Supermajor 胜者组 BO3 第三场 6.5
2018/06/06 DOTA
[01:33]PWL开团时刻DAY2-开雾与反开雾
2020/10/31 DOTA
[08:08]DOTA2-DPC中国联赛2月28日Recap集锦
2021/03/11 DOTA
Python基类函数的重载与调用实例分析
2015/01/12 Python
Django框架教程之正则表达式URL误区详解
2018/01/28 Python
Python中的上下文管理器和with语句的使用
2018/04/17 Python
Python中pandas模块DataFrame创建方法示例
2018/06/20 Python
Django异步任务线程池实现原理
2019/12/17 Python
使用pytorch和torchtext进行文本分类的实例
2020/01/08 Python
python3访问字典里的值实例方法
2020/11/18 Python
使用pandas实现筛选出指定列值所对应的行
2020/12/13 Python
医科大学生的自我评价
2013/12/04 职场文书
网络程序员自荐信
2014/01/25 职场文书
护士毕业实习感言
2014/03/05 职场文书
解析:创业计划书和商业计划书二者之间到底有什么区别
2019/08/14 职场文书
游戏开发中如何使用CocosCreator进行音效处理
2021/04/14 Javascript
解决golang 关于全局变量的坑
2021/05/06 Golang
python Django框架快速入门教程(后台管理)
2021/07/21 Python